The next thing is the HUD, it is now simpler and more user friendly, not to mention that I added "gestures" to make the player more comfortable.
(that's a bit complicated to explain, but when playing you will notice how efficient it is)
Now you can only load 3 items, clicking on a slot will deselect that item, or if you press the keys "1" "2" or "3.
And a small gear icon, which by pressing it you access the configuration command.
(Also I remove the temperature bar, it was a bit unneeded )
Now when you pick up items, they will be placed in your hands and on your head, it's a small detail but I find it very cute to see Nora balancing objects on her head haha
I have been working on more objects for the puzzles, one of the latest being the security cameras.
You can move the camera around the room and they also have night vision (something essential for some puzzles).
